The MX5KP8.0CA diode has a standard DO-201AD package with two leads. The anode is connected to the positive side, and the cathode is connected to the negative side.
When a transient voltage spike occurs, the MX5KP8.0CA diode conducts and shunts the excess current to protect the connected circuitry. It operates by rapidly transitioning into a low-resistance state when exposed to overvoltage conditions.
The MX5KP8.0CA diode is commonly used in various applications, including: - Power supplies - Telecommunication equipment - Automotive electronics - Industrial control systems - Consumer electronics
